The RWD-21 is a two-seat, cantilever low-wing wooded touring aircraft that was intended to be simple, cheap and easy to fly. This is the prototype and first flew in February 1939. At the outbreak of WWII five aircraft had been completed. In September 1939 this plane and SP-BRH were flown to Romania where they survived the war. In Romania SP-BRE was re-registered and flown as YR-VEN but returned in 1948 to Poland and became SP-AKG with the Warsaw Aeroklub. It joined this super museum in 1963 and was subsequently restored to its pre-WWII colour scheme and registration.

The Flaming (Flamingo) is a Polish STOL intended as a successor to the successful utility aircraft PZL-104 Wilga. This is the first prototype and was first flown in November 1989. A second prototype was flown in July 1991 (SP-PRD), also on display at the Muzeum Lotnictwa Polskiego. However, problems with funding at the outbreak of the 1980s and 1990s and the political upheaval at that time, coupled with the wish to prioritise the PZL-130 Orlik trainer program caused the Flaming program to be suspended.

This airframe was built in 1956 and primarliy used for testing throughout her service life, firstly by de Haviland, then by AAEE Boscombe Down and finally by the RAE. In 1969 she was acquired by the IWM and displayed at the Shuttleworth Collection at Old Warden before moving to Duxford in 1971 and Krakow in 2012.

In 1948 LWD developed the Zuch 1 trainer and aerobatic aircraft from the LWD Junak. The aircraft was powered by a Czech Walter Minor 160 hp inline engine, however, the Poles were refused a licence for production of these engines. Therefore, the Zuch 2 was developed with a German Siemens Bramo radial engine instead but this produced only 116 hp. The Zuch 2 was unsurprisingly inferior to the Zuch 1 and only 5 were built, these were operated by flying clubs until 1955. This example is now on display at this super museum.

In the autumn of 1945, this P-39 was found complete (and presumably still crated) on a stray railway wagon near Radom. It was still it its USAAF markings so, presumably, a lend lease airframe that had been transported to the front, but as the war had progressed the plane had become surplus to requirements. The Airacobra was puchased by the Wawelberg & Rotwand Technical School in Warsaw and used for instructional teaching. It then passed to the Mechanical Faculty of the Warsaw University of Technology, however, in all the intervening years the fuselage, the serial and other parts have become lost.

This B.II was built in 1917 at Zeesen in Germany and went on to serve with the Imperial German Air Force and is the only surviving airframe of its type. At some point prior to 1936 it became part of Hermann Göring's pre-WWII collection that formed the Deutsche Luftfahrtsammlung (German Collections of Aircraft). After several pieces were lost during a bombing attack in 1943, the remainder were crudely cut up, packed onto wagons and tranported east for safekeeping. In 1945 the remnants were discovered in very poor condition near the village of Hammer (now Kuźnica Czarnkowska) by the Polish Army.

The Pirat was a very successful glider design used for advanced training with a total of 813 produced and exported to some 25 countries. This example is the second prototype that was first flown during August 1966. It is obviously of valuable historical importance and so was purchased for the museum in November 2020 from the Polish Airlines Aero Club.

This Fishbed-J was accepted into the Polish AF in April 1974 and went on to fly with various regiments during its service career. One of these was the 10th Fighter Aviation Regiment based at Lask, which it joined in August 1993. In 2000 the plane was painted in this golden scheme to celebrate the 55th anniversary of the regiment's foundation. In January 2003 the plane was retired and stored for three years at Lask before being placed at this wonderful museum.

The Grigorovich M-15 was a successful Russian WWI reconnaisance biplane flying boat but due to a shortage of engines was only built in small numbers. This example was delivered to the air squadron of the Arensburg fortress on the Baltic Isle of Saarema. It was captured by the Germans during Operation Albion in October 1917 and sent to the German Naval Research Center at Warnemünde for evaluation. It was later part of Göring's pre-WWII private collection in Berlin that was transported to Poland for safekeeping due to the danger of Allied bombing. This M-15 is the only surviving example.

This Hawk II was built in 1933 and transported by liner SS Europa from the USA to Germany. It firstly became D-3164 and then D-IRIK in April 1934. For the next four years it was the personal plane of the famous Ernst Udet, later Generaloberst of Luftwaffe, and flown during the opening ceremony of the 1936 Olympics in Berlin. After 1937 it was displayed in Herman Göring's private collection, the Deutsche Luftfahrtsammlung, in Berlin but was damaged during an air raid in November 1943. The collection was evacuated to occupied Poland and in 1963 the remnants became part of this great museum.
